Most common problems
Service Brakes, Hydraulic:Antilock/Traction Control/Electronic Limited Slip is the most frequently named component, appearing in 23 of 34 complaints (67.6%). A complaint can name multiple components.

Examples from the source records
Examples provide context, not a representative sample or a verified diagnosis.
Owner report 10015306 · 2003-04-11 (April 11, 2003)
THE CONSUMER WANTED TO BE REIMBURSED FOR A FAULTY ANTI-LOCK BRAKE SYSTEM WHICH WAS REPAIRED AT HER EXPENSE, HOWEVER THERE WAS A RECALL REGARDING THE ISSUE, BUT CONSUMER WAS TOLD BY THE MANUFACTURER, SHE WAS NOT ENTITLED TO BE REIMBURSED SINCE THE RECALL WAS OVER. *AK *JB *TS
Owner-reported narrative. 131,513 miles reported. Look up ODI 10015306 at NHTSA ↗
Owner report 10024968 · 2003-06-20 (June 20, 2003)
RECALL REGARDING THE ABS PUMP SYSTEM. *MR THE CONSUMER EXPERIENCED A PROBLEM WITH THE ABS LIGHT AND THE BRAKE PEDAL WAS HARD TO STOP. THE ABS PUMP ASSEMBLY WAS REPLACED. *SCC *JB
Owner-reported narrative. Look up ODI 10024968 at NHTSA ↗
Owner report 10026352 · 2003-06-27 (June 27, 2003)
REPLACEMENT OF ABS PUMP SYSTEM. *MR ABS LIGHT WAS ON AND THE PEDAL WAS HARD TO PUSH TO MAKE A STOP. DEALER REPLACED ABS PUMP ASSEMBLY AT CONSUMER'S EXPENSE. DEALER WOULD NOT HONOR RECALL REPAIRS BECAUSE THE RECALL WAS OVER. *TT *JB
Owner-reported narrative. 131,593 miles reported. Look up ODI 10026352 at NHTSA ↗

Recall history
2 distinct campaigns affect this selection. Announcement dates below are different from vehicle model years. A campaign may cover multiple years.
92V015000 · Steering: Steering Wheel/Handle Bar
Reported: 1992-02-14 (February 14, 1992)
THE ZINC PLATING OPERATION PERFORMED ON THE UPPER STEERING COLUMN SHAFT COUPLING BOLT CAUSED HYDROGEN EMBRITTLEMENT AND BREAKAGE OF THE BOLT.
Consequence: FRACTURES OF THE UPPER STEERING COLUMN SHAFT COUPLINGBOLT RESULT IN A LACK OF COUPLING LOAD ON THE SHAFT AND LOSS OF STEERINGCONTROL.
Remedy: REPLACE THE ZINC PLATED BOLT WITH A PHOSPHATE PLATED BOLT.
NHTSA campaign record ↗96V099000 · Service Brakes, Hydraulic:Antilock/Traction Control/Electronic Limited Slip
Reported: 1996-06-13 (June 13, 1996)
THE ABS HYDRAULIC CONTROL UNIT CAN EXPERIENCE EXCESSIVE BRAKE ACTUATOR PISTON SEAL WEAR CAUSING PUMP-MOTOR DETERIORATION.
Consequence: IF THIS CONDITION OCCURS, THE ABS FUNCTION COULD BE LOST AND REDUCED POWER ASSIST WOULD BE EXPERIENCED DURING VEHICLE BRAKING INCREASING THE POTENTIAL FOR A VEHICLE ACCIDENT.
Remedy: DEALERS WILL TEST THE VEHICLE'S ANTI-LOCK BRAKE SYSTEM AND REPAIR THE VEHICLES IF NECESSARY. ALSO THE WARRANTY ON ALL ABS COMPONENTS WILL BE EXTENDED TO 10 YEARS OR 100,000 MILES (EXCEPT FOR THE BRAKE ACTUATOR PISTON ASSEMBLY AND THE PUMP-MOTOR ASSEMBLY WHICH WILL HAVE A LIFETIME COVERAGE). OWNERS WILL ALSO BE REIMBURSED FOR PREVIOUS ABS COMPONENT REPAIR COSTS.
